Don't chase Teemo through unwarded areas — that's often exactly what he wants.
Teemo is a ranged lane bully who excels at poke, vision control, and frustrating melee champions. He wants to wear enemies down with poison while controlling areas using Noxious Trap (R) — his mushroom traps. Many beginners become impatient and chase Teemo through trapped areas.

QWhat it does
Obscures an enemy's vision and blinds them dealing damage.
How to play against
Being blinded makes your basic attacks miss. Don't auto-attack during the blind — use abilities only.
WWhat it does
Passive: gains Move Speed until struck by an enemy champion. Active: grants sprint briefly.
How to play against
He's surprisingly fast. Don't chase him without a CC ability — he outruns most champions.
EWhat it does
Passive: each basic attack poisons and slows on-hit.
How to play against
Every auto poisons and slows. Don't let him freely auto you — back away after each hit.
RWhat it does
Places invisible exploding mushrooms anywhere.
How to play against
Mushrooms cover the entire map late game. Use a Sweeper constantly. Don't enter unwarded areas or brush.

Guerrilla Warfare: if he stands still briefly he goes invisible. He can hide anywhere by simply standing still in a bush. He's a permanent ambush threat in brush — use a sweeper.
